原文:beego高级查询

ORM以QuerySeter来组织查询,每个返回QuerySeter的方法都会获得一个新的QuerySeter对象。 基本使用方法: o : orm.NewOrm 获取 QuerySeter 对象,user 为表名 qs : o.QueryTable user 也可以直接使用对象作为表名 user : new User qs o.QueryTable user 返回 QuerySeter .exp ...

2020-11-17 14:39 0 437 推荐指数:

查看详情

beego——高级查询

ORM以QuerySeter来组织查询,每个返回QuerySeter的方法都会获得一个新的QuerySeter对象。 基本使用方法: o := orm.NewOrm() // 获取 QuerySeter 对象,user 为表名 qs := o.QueryTable("user ...

Sun Dec 16 10:38:00 CST 2018 0 5044
Go语言之高级beego框架之model设计构造查询

一、model设计构造查询 QueryBuilder 提供了一个简便,流畅的 SQL 查询构造器。在不影响代码可读性的前提下用来快速的建立 SQL 语句。 QueryBuilder 在功能上与 ORM 重合, 但是各有利弊。ORM 更适用于简单的 CRUD 操作,而 QueryBuilder ...

Thu Feb 14 17:55:00 CST 2019 0 592
beego——原生SQL查询

使用Raw SQL查询,无需使用ORM表定义。 多数据库,都可直接使用占位符号?,自动转换。 查询时的参数,支持使用Model Struct和Slice,Array ids := []int{1, 2, 3} p.Raw("SELECT name FROM user WHERE id ...

Sun Dec 16 10:58:00 CST 2018 0 2691
高级查询

高级查询 聚合函数 (一)COUNT()函数:用来统计记录的条数 语法格式如下所示: SELECT COUNT(*) FROM 表名; 例如:(1)查询student表中一共有多少条记录,SQL语句及其执行结果如下所示: (二) SUM()函数:用于求出 ...

Tue Nov 26 01:21:00 CST 2019 0 258
[Beego模型] 四、使用SQL语句进行查询

[Beego模型] 一、ORM 使用方法 [Beego模型] 二、CRUD 操作 [Beego模型] 三、高级查询 [Beego模型] 四、使用SQL语句进行查询 [Beego模型] 五、构造查询 [Beego模型] 六、事务处理 使用 Raw SQL 查询,无需使用 ...

Thu Aug 17 18:32:00 CST 2017 0 2093
Go语言之高级beego框架之Controller

一、Controller 控制器 Controller等同于Django里的view,处理逻辑都是在Controller里面完成的,下面就写一个最简单的Controller。写controller的时候,一定要继承beego.Controller,也一定要记得导入 github.com ...

Tue Feb 12 22:46:00 CST 2019 0 2703
Go语言之高级beego框架安装与使用

一、beego框架 1、beego框架简介 beego 是一个快速开发 Go 应用的 HTTP 框架,他可以用来快速开发 API、Web 及后端服务等各种应用,是一个 RESTful 的框架,主要设计灵感来源于 tornado、sinatra 和 flask 这三个框架,但是结合了 Go ...

Tue Jan 29 21:57:00 CST 2019 0 1803
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M